Output 86ed66ecb7008a50f614d9de6234861dd23fc378e30c570ab5e059cd730bc1a8:1

value
3139987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 839376f576ecaa7c8b655911d59c567fb0f1b6ac OP_EQUAL
address
3Dgj6hWptBtXKVkLzCLmaE2VGnAL6xsFjh
transaction
86ed66ecb7008a50f614d9de6234861dd23fc378e30c570ab5e059cd730bc1a8
spent
true